What is the correct order of skincare products?
So, you’ve got all the right (and hopefully clean and safe!) skincare products—fancy serums, hydrating creams, and SPF (we’ll get to that). But before you dive in and start slathering them on in a frenzy, let’s pump the brakes for a hot minute. The order of skincare products is just as important as what’s in the bottle. Bestie real talk, if you’re applying products in the wrong order, you might be pouring your money right down the drain which of course we don’t want that to happen!
Here’s a 5 step skincare routine in the right order to get you moving and grooving in the right direction! If 5 steps feels like too much in the beginning, prioritize cleansing and moisturizing to start.

Which skincare product should I use first?
1. Cleanse – The Foundation of Your Routine
Start with a clean slate, literally. No matter your skin type or concerns, your skincare routine should always begin with a thorough cleanse. Cleansing is how you get rid of dirt, oil, makeup, the pizza sauce your child wiped on your face, and other impurities that accumulate on your skin throughout the day. Without a proper cleanse, the rest of your order of skincare products won’t be nearly as effective, as leftover grime can prevent other products from properly absorbing into your skin. Not great.
Choose a cleanser based on your skin type. Got oily skin? Grab a foaming or gel cleanser. Dry skin? You’ll want something creamy or oil-based like this one.
This first step in your order of skin care gets rid of the gunk so the good stuff can actually get to work. Plus, a freshly cleaned and refreshed face is truly the best feeling, wouldn’t you agree?
2. Toner or Essence – Prepping Your Skin for Greatness
Next up in the order of skincare products: toner or essence. After cleansing, your skin needs to be prepped to fully absorb the active ingredients that will follow in the next steps. This is where toner or essence comes in. This is definitely one of the most underrated steps in the order of skincare products.
I know, toners have a reputation from back in the day for being harsh and stripping, but modern formulas are more like a refreshing drink for your skin.
They balance your skin’s pH, gently exfoliate, and prep it for everything that follows.
Essences, on the other hand, are more hydrating and designed to boost moisture while preparing the skin to receive subsequent treatments. I’ve used both and I tend to learn more towards a simple toner right now.
You can pour a little toner or essence into your hands (or on a cotton pad, if you’re feeling fancy) and gently press it into your skin.
When deciding the right order for skin care, always apply toner or essence right after cleansing. Whether you’re combating oiliness or dryness, adding a toner or essence to your routine makes a noticeable difference in the hydration and health of your skin.
3. Serums – Targeted Treatments for Your Skin Concerns
Now for the fun part—serums! Once your skin is clean and prepped, it’s time to apply serums. Serums are concentrated formulas packed with active ingredients like vitamin C, hyaluronic acid, peptides and bakuchiol (a safer alternative to retinol) just to name a few. These products target specific skin concerns, from brightening dull skin to smoothing fine lines and wrinkles. Think of this as your “treatment” step.
Here’s the deal: Serums are lightweight and should always go before heavier creams in the order of skincare products. They’re designed to penetrate deeper, so if you put a moisturizer on first, you’re just blocking their path. You will want to choose a serum based on your individual needs—vitamin C is great for brightening, hyaluronic acid for hydration, and bakuchiol for anti-aging.
Apply your chosen serum by patting it onto the skin—don’t rub, as this can reduce the efficacy of the product. If you’re using multiple serums be sure to apply them in order of texture, from thinnest to thickest. For example, I use 2 serums regularly, a Vitamin C serum and a hydrating serum. I apply the hydrating serum first because it is thinner than my current Vitamin C serum.
Always allow each serum to fully absorb before moving to the next step. I usually brush my teeth while my serum is settling in before I apply moisturizer.
If you want to use an eye cream, then you would insert it here after serums and before your overall face moisturizer. Eye creams are formulated to target puffiness, fine lines, and dark circles. The skin around the eyes is super delicate so you’ll want to handle it with care and gently tap your eye cream under your eyes. I recently discovered an eye cream that I absolutely love because it has a cooling applicator, making it like a massage whenever I use it!
In the order of skincare products, eye cream comes before your heavier moisturizers because the skin around your eyes absorbs things faster.
4. Moisturizer – Locking in Hydration
We are now locking it down! Once your serums and eye creams are absorbed, it’s time to lock in all that hydration with a good moisturizer. Moisturizers form a protective barrier over the skin, sealing in moisture and preventing it from evaporating throughout the day. When it comes to the order of skincare products, moisturizers are essential in maintaining the health of your skin barrier. Consider it the protective top coat of your skin.
For daytime, it is good to use a lightweight lotion or gel that won’t feel too heavy under makeup or sunscreen. At night, you can go for a richer cream to repair and hydrate your skin while you sleep. Be sure to choose a moisturizer that suits your skin type, as using a product that’s too heavy or too light can disrupt your skin’s natural balance.
5. Sunscreen – Your Final Protective Layer (Daytime Only)
If you’re serious about protecting your skin from aging and environmental damage, which you are since you’re reading this, sunscreen is a non-negotiable step in your morning routine. The order of face products always ends with sunscreen in the daytime, as it needs to sit on top of your moisturizer to effectively block harmful UV rays.
When choosing a sunscreen it is important to stay away from ingredients like Oxybenzone, Octinoxate, and other chemicals that are harmful to your health. Look for a sunscreen with Zinc Oxide as its active ingredient.
Make sure to apply your sunscreen generously as the final step in your order for skin care routine before heading out for the day.
